Transaction 23f21c2c0d1d1b1d529f5bb10d006631eafe874903fa9cb05957e01c2c3e16ab
3 Input
2 Outputs
- 23f21c2c0d1d1b1d529f5bb10d006631eafe874903fa9cb05957e01c2c3e16ab:0
- 23f21c2c0d1d1b1d529f5bb10d006631eafe874903fa9cb05957e01c2c3e16ab:1
value 6100000
address 3JW44CW3bhdxab2bnffoZBihBqneKiGAXf
value 2646265
address 1FtmJxEHrDAC1ocvyNypzWvUnDHkZJAY5f